Pope County, Minnesota property tax

The median homeowner in Pope County, Minnesota pays $1,915 a year in property tax on a home worth $242,800, an effective rate of 0.79%. The national effective rate is 0.98%.

What the rate means here

At 0.79%, Pope County taxes property more lightly than the national 0.98%. With a median home at $242,800, that produces a bill of $1,915. Somebody still funds the schools, so it is worth knowing what a low-tax county collects instead.

It ranks #73 of 83 Minnesota counties by effective rate, against a statewide 1.04%, and #1,489 nationally. The state runs from 1.24% in Ramsey County down to 0.57% in Aitkin County.

The median home costs 3.36 times the median household income of $72,205, close to the national 3.86. This is a small rural county of 11,363 people. Five-year survey estimates for places this size carry wide margins of error, so treat the figures as approximate.
